Organize and Synthesize Information Introduction Information must be organized in order to permit analysis, synthesis, understanding, and communication. One way to organize the information you have gathered is to group materials by similar concepts or content. For example, if you are doing research on the wine industry you can organize the data into several folders or "baskets": - Wineries
- Laws and Regulations
- Vineyards
- Costs of Operations
- Land use
- Demographics of consumers
- Governmental publications (Crushed grape report)
- Global competition (Australia, Italy)
